A highway patrolman sends a 28.250 GHz radar beam toward a speeding car. The reflected wave is lower in frequency by 2.97 kHz. What is the speed of the car? [Hint: For small values of x, the following approximation may be used: (1+x)2≈1+2x. ]

The only equation on my equation sheet for our exam is f=f^1(1+-U/C) .I am not sure how to apply this information. If you manipulate the equation can you explain how/why? Thanks! ( I tried 31.54 m/s but that was incorrect.)
